In Harrison, NJ, a town known for its evolving industrial landscape and proximity to Newark, the availability of Virtual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P) is crucial for those facing mental health and substance use challenges. This innovative approach to treatment allows residents to access quality care from the comfort of their homes, making it easier to maintain their daily commitments, such as work and family obligations.
Residents of Harrison can greatly benefit from Virtual IOP by accessing structured therapy sessions that fit their schedules. With a strong emphasis on evidence-based treatments like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), individuals can work on issues such as anxiety, depression, PTSD, and substance use disorders. The ability to attend sessions without the need for travel is a game changer, especially for those balancing busy lives.
Getting started with a Virtual IOP in Harrison is straightforward. Programs typically offer 9 to 20 hours of structured therapy each week, with sessions occurring 3-5 days per week. Licensed therapists and counselors are ready to provide individual, group, and family therapy tailored to meet specific needs.
